`Think ahead of RTI, PSGA, Panchay at elections' | No more boasting please! | | Early Times Report srinagar, July 30: National Conference today directed the rank and file of the party to be vigilant and give befitting reply to mischievous elements involved in malicious propaganda against the party. Addressing a workers meeting at Nawa-i-Subh Complex, Party's Additional General Secretary Sheikh Mustafa Kamaal said the coalition Government under dynamic leadership of Omar Abdullah has given the best governance in the State and the State is progressing in all spheres of life. There is no denying the fact that the NC led coalition extended the RTI Act, held Panchayati elections and gave the Public service Guarantee Act but, can all this paper work be termed development. A student of media in Kashmir University has kept a track of NC's statements/speeches since last year. According to him, the party has boasted of holding Panchayat elections, RTI Act and the Public Service Guarantee Act 300 times. What is visible on the ground? After Ghulam Muhammad Shah's regime, the people are on the roads to protest shortage of electricity and potable water for the first time. This is how things have moved during Omar led coalition. Kamaal said the National Conference had been working for fulfilling the dreams of Sher-e-Kashmir. Kamaal is right. Sher-e-Kashmir's only dream was power and he got it. The National Conference, political circles believe can go to any extent for power. Kamaal accused PDP of extending AFSPA to the State. He also expressed his determination to repeal the law. While repeal of AFSPA at the hands of NC seems a distant dream, a PDP activist has a question for Kamaal. Who extended POTA and who created Special Operations Group (SOG)? |
